Nalchik resident fined for justifying terrorism
2023-12-16
Direct Translation via Google Translate. Edited.
[KavkazUzel] A court in Rostov-on-Don found a social media post by Nalchik resident Lion Pheshkhov to justify terrorism and sentenced him to a fine of 320 thousand rubles. 
What kind of terrorist he might be remains, however, remains undefined.
Nalchik resident Lion Pheshkhov was found guilty of justifying terrorism (Part 2 of Article 205.2 of the Criminal Code of the Russian Federation). The Southern District Military Court sentenced him to a fine of 320,000 rubles and deprivation of the right to administer websites for two years, RIA Kabardino-Balkaria reported today. with reference to the press service of the FSB department for the republic.

According to the investigation and the court, he posted text materials on one of the social networks containing justification for terrorist activities, the report says. 

As follows from the case file on the website of the Southern District Military Court, the case of Lion Pheshkhov was submitted to the court in June, and five court hearings were held.

"Caucasian Knot" also wrote that a resident of the Urvansky district, as a minor, posted audio recordings on social networks with calls for terrorism and justification for such actions, the investigation suggested, announcing the transfer of the case to court.
